What Is the Cost of Living Near Salt Lake City?

Understanding the cost of living near Salt Lake City is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at The Dancing Doe.
Salt Lake City's Cost of Living Index is approximately 104.3 (4.3% more expensive than US average; 2.8% more than UT average). State capital, growing tech scene, housing costs above US avg. UTA bus/TRAX/FrontRunner. When planning your budget based on a salary from The Dancing Doe,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,300 - $1,900+ A significant portion of The Dancing Doe sal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$100 - $180 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$85 (UT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$410 - $600 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$750+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,675 - $4,135+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
